分点, 春分点或秋分点
(astronomy) either of the two celestial points at which the celestial equator intersects the ecliptic

2
分点, 昼夜平分点
either of the two moments in a year when the Sun, in its apparent motion along the ecliptic, crosses the celestial equator, resulting in approximately equal periods of daylight and darkness worldwide
- The spring equinox marks the beginning of spring in the Northern Hemisphere.
春分标志着北半球春天的开始。
- During the autumn equinox, the length of day and night are nearly equal.
在秋分期间,白天和黑夜的长度几乎相等。
- The equinox occurs twice a year, once in March and once in September.
春分一年发生两次,一次在三月,一次在九月。
- On the equinox, the Sun rises due east and sets due west.
在春分或秋分时,太阳正东升起,正西落下。
- The equinoxes are important for astronomers studying the Earth's tilt and orbit.
分点对于研究地球倾斜和轨道的天文学家来说很重要。
